In Arizona, you must be 21 years old to buy a handgun from a licensed dealer. It’s that simple. If you thought the answer could be 18 years old, you're not alone, but that number only applies when purchasing rifles or shotguns. Confusing, right?

Now, that's not to say minors can't have any sort of access to handguns. In Arizona, state law allows those under 21 to possess handguns under certain circumstances. For example, if they’re with a parent or guardian—talk about a family outing with a twist! Or let’s say they’re out hunting or engaging in target shooting activities—then it’s all within the law.
